Spain - FDI Inflows to Agriculture, Forestry and Seafood

With $59.75 Million in 2017, the country was number 15 among other countries in FDI Inflows to Agriculture, Forestry and Seafood. Spain is overtaken by Italy, which was ranked number 14 with $67.91 Million and is followed by United Kingdom at $59.5 Million. Oman topped the ranking with $2,409.62 Million in 2017, that is a fall of 7.1% compared to 2016. Indonesia, United States and Colombia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ta witnessed the best average annual growth at +76% per year, while Mauritius recorded the worst performance at -61.9% per year.
